Case summary
These Case-Mate Safe Mate Universal UV Box products are misbranded pursuant to 7 U.S.C. ? 136(q)(1) and 40 C.F.R. ? 156.10(a)(5), because they contain statements (quoted above) that are false or misleading as defined by the regulation. These products are also misbranded pursuant to 7 U.S.C. ? 136(q)(1) because they lack the information required by statute to be on their labels (i.e., directions for use, caution or warning statement, and EPA establishment number). Therefore, sale or distribution of the products in the shipment referenced above is a violation of FIFRA section 12(a)(1)(F), 7 U.S.C. 136j(a)(1)(F).
